Research on Modeling and Simulation of Anti-Missile Interception for the Ship-to-Air Missile

Jing Tao

Open publisher page 0 citations

Abstract

According to the different interception style of ship-to-air missiles, the model of anti-missile interception for the ship-to-air missile is constructed under circumstances of self-interception and cooperative-interception.Then the simulation is conducted in MATLAB where the parameters of the model have the classic value.The results show that in the defensive operation,the ships should be arranged vertically to the moving direction of anti-ship missile,which not only do good to decrease the interception probability of the guided radar of the anti-ship missile,but decreases the outer defense-break probability of anti-ship missile through increasing the number of interception.Thus the surviving ability of the ship could be enhanced.
